A loose chain will more than likely jump the cam gear and throw the timing out of place.As far I know, the only sign of a problem you 'll receive is when the engine blows as a result of this. However,this isn 't a likely scenario with the 4.6. The weak link in the timing chain set up isn 't the chain but the chain tensioners. Signs to look/listen for would bea ticking sound.
